On Wednesday night, more than 100 people came to Lucia in the North End of Boston to celebrate its 35 years in business. The Frattaroli Family opened the family restaurant shortly after coming to Boston from the Abruzzo region of Italy.
Friends, family and local celebs attended the event where the owners of Lucia, Donato and Filippo Frattaroli, donated $3,500 to the Boston Bruins Foundation. The Foundation provides grants to organizations that meet the standards of its mission, concentrating on the following four areas where it is best able to enrich the community: athletics, academics, health and community outreach.
Attendees included Car Czar Herb Chambers, NHL Commentator Kathryn Tappen and Former Bruins Player and Foundation Executive Director Bob Sweeney.
